PSCC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

37 of the 8,270 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co S&P SmallCap Consumer Staples ETF (PSCC)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$12.4M — down 15% from $14.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 11 funds closed out of PSCC and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 12 trimmed existing stakes and 11 added.

The largest buyer was IHT Wealth Management, adding an estimated $956K. The largest seller was Osaic Holdings, cutting an estimated $1.03M.
